DJ Steve Thorpe – LIVE @ Moovin Festival 2017
For the third year running I headed to Stockport (UK) on our August bank holiday to the awesome, Moovin Festival. This cracking little festival is one that I highly recommend and to find out more about it, you can read a review I did of it in 2015 when you *Click Here*.
Before you do that though, get this mix from Steve Thorpe downloaded so as your reading is accompanied by a damn fine soundtrack. Steve closed the Boombox stage on Sunday night and as I’ve seen him DJ several times now, I knew something special was gonna go down and so did a lot of other people judging by how many turned up to see him play. With the tent over flowing with people who wanted to end the weekend on a real high, Steve stepped up and delivered a blinding set that was heavy with Breaks and a touch of Acid House and Techno to boot. All of us left wanting more but as is the way with life, all good things must come to an end, so we all wandered off back to our tents with big smiles on our faces safe in the knowledge we’d ended an amazing weekend the right way by dancing our socks off!

MDE ‘Move It Up’ ft The Ragga Twins (Get Twisted Records)

https://www.beatport.com/track/move-it-up-original-mix/9682419
MDE collab with The Ragga Twins for Tech Bass Banger ‘Move It Up’ on Get Twisted Records- one for the ravin cru! Oldskool ravers know and love The Ragga Twins. The iconic duo played a huge part in the 90s rave scene with their own tracks and through lending their distinctive vocals to countless rave, jungle, DnB and fidget/dirty house classics.
MDE enlisted the vocal support of these rave veterans for ‘Move It Up’ on the Get Twisted imprint, a track with plenty of 90s rave nostalgia embedded into the banging up to date Tech Bass beats. MDE return to their My Digital Enemy days here with a high energy tune perfect for high energy DJ sets!

Digeridoo (Elite Force Revamp)
It’s not very often these days that we get to bring you a Breakbeat masterpiece from, Elite Force. Simon Shackleton sent his Elite Force alias on a long term hiatus quite some time ago, but he has recently uploaded his revamp of Aphex Twin’s seminal ‘Digeridoo’ which he’s also giving it away for free, which we’re incredibly grateful for and I’m sure many of you will be to. It was first released back in 2011, but with the added drums and a heavy Acid Breaks sound, it’ll still tear the dance floor a new one right here, right now!
If you’re a fan of Elite Force, we have some very exciting news for you as he is playing a one off gig in Manchester on November 25th. He’ll be playing for Manchester’s longest running Breaks night, Lowdown, who are sadly saying goodbye to the venue they called home for so many years, Sound Control. Butch le Butch – Theme From Shanty Town
Australia has served up a high number of top draw producers from various underground scenes and another one we’ve recently had the pleasure of discovering is, Butch le Butch. He was bitten by the Disco bug at a young age and has been infected by the groove ever since. After honing his skills behind the decks in clubs in Melbourne, it was time for him to experiment with making music of his own and it’s a decision we’re very thankful he made as the music we’ve listened to of his, is absolute first class! Butch produces Disco gems of his own and he also remixes very familiar tunes from the scene, as well as rare and forgotten about ones to.
As a welcome to the LSM ward, we’re sharing with you Butch’s joyous tune ‘Theme From Shanty Town’ which will only ever bring light to the darkest of days. Sweet Disco vibes, the smoothest of grooves and plenty of horns makes this a winner with us and we’re sure you’re gonna love it to. Happy times incoming!
